Greens MP announces $300,000 in community funding

Community organisations in the Balmain electorate will receive close to $300,000 in funding after they were recommended by Greens MP Jamie Parker under the NSW government's Community Building Partnerships Program.



"I am delighted to announce the community organisations which have been successful in their applications for funding," Mr Parker said.

"I congratulate these projects on having put forward excellent community building proposals.

"I supported these projects because I believe these organisations are doing invaluable work in our community and I want to do everything I can to help.

"Funding will go to a number of worthy projects including new playground equipment for Nicholson Street Public school in Balmain East as well as a playgroup at Rozelle Neighbourhood Centre, assistance for a disability services provider in Haberfield, developing a sports court in Glebe and renovating the P&C canteen at Leichhardt Public School.

"I will continue to support community organisations which are doing important work in our neighbourhoods," Mr Parker said.
